Avid Media LTD

Call
328 Main St
Yarmouth, NS B5A 1E4

Tri-Star - Avid Media is a multimedia production company based in Yarmouth, NS, specializing in creating content for various platforms.

With a focus on video production and digital media services, Tri-Star - Avid Media caters to a diverse range of clients seeking high-quality visual content.

Generated from their business information

Own this business?
See a problem?

You might also like

CanadaNova ScotiaYarmouthAvid Media LTD

Partial Data by Foursquare.